This is a data pack that makes every single item be stackable up to 99! You can go mining, exploring or more with a much more organised inventory since slots now hold 30% more items and blocks! This even works with items that can only be stacked to less than 64, like doors and swords. The pack was originally intended to increase the stack size to the 32-bit integer limit, 2147483647, but the vanilla formatting that this pack uses only allows up to 99, and having too high of a stack size could cause tons of memory leaks. Note that only items that have been picked up/been in entity format can stack higher than 64! Getting items straight from the creative inventory or /give will make them have their old limits until dropped and picked up again! Also note that if you don't have the strongest processor and have too many big items could cause lag! Regardless of your PC, I recommend allocating at least 4GB of RAM to Minecraft if possible, since even if you have a strong PC Minecraft is limited to the RAM you allocate. (I would only advise you to do that if you have 8GB+ memory) If you want to add some items that can't be stacked to 99 go to data/mega_stacks/tags/item/not_valid.json and edit the file.
